Qingquan Luo is a leading thoracic surgeon and researcher whose work has significantly advanced the field of minimally invasive thoracic surgery, with particular expertise in robotic-assisted surgical techniques for lung cancer and thoracic oncology. His research systematically compares robotic-assisted thoracic surgery (RATS) against conventional video-assisted thoracoscopic surgery (VATS) and open thoracotomy across a range of clinical contexts — from early-stage lung cancer to locally advanced non-small cell lung cancer (NSCLC) and thymomas. Luo's most cited work, including a 2019 comparison of robotic versus VATS lobectomy for stage IIB–IIIA NSCLC (74 citations) and a 2017 multi-approach thymoma study (63 citations), has helped establish evidence-based guidance for surgical decision-making in challenging oncologic cases. Notably, his randomized controlled trials evaluating RATS in clinical N2-stage NSCLC patients represent some of the most rigorous evidence in this domain, demonstrating comparable long-term survival with reduced perioperative complications. Luo has also contributed to surgical robotics innovation, co-authoring reviews on emerging robotic platforms and the development of the modular SHURUI continuum surgical system (57 citations).
